Senior Data Analyst II, Supply Chain

Remote Full-time
Dandy is transforming the massive and antiquated dental industry—an industry worth over $200B. Backed by some of the world’s leading venture capital firms, we’re on an ambitious mission to simplify and modernize every function of the dental practice through technology. As we expand our reach globally, Dandy is building the operating system for dental offices around the world—empowering clinicians and their teams with technology, innovation, and world-class support to achieve more for their practices, their people, and their patients.Revolutionizing the dental industry is hard…and we need help.We're on the hunt for experienced senior data analysts who can tackle some of our most significant challenges in the realm of analytics for our supply chain. Our supply chain plays a critical role in Dandy's dental operations, overseeing critical areas like manufacturing, logistics/procurement, on-time measurement, product feature enhancement for better quality, and capacity/utilization optimization. In this dynamic, cross-functional role, you'll have the freedom to independently harness data expertise to build products and drive recommendations that propel Dandy to become the top dental lab in the industry.Your responsibilities/opportunitiesBuild production models to automate and optimize decision processes within our manufacturing facilitiesDrive performance within Supply Chain & Operations through experimentation and simulation modelingDevelop and share insights that influence the various supply teams and partner functions, such as operations and product.Define the data language (i.e. KPIs, dashboards, measurement, etc) within Supply Chain & Operations to reduce ambiguity and drive accountabilityActively uplevel the Data organization through mentoring other analystsTravel of up to 15% is required in this roleAbout you:6+ years of experience working in data science and analytics, ideally within supply chain, manufacturing, or operations functionsBA/BS in a quantitative field such as computer science, operations research, statistics, engineering or a BA/BS in behavioral science (economics, psychology, etc) with an applied background in dataExcellent SQL and Python skillsStrong communication skills and experience communicating results in a way that drives change.
